Canada Natural Health Product Reg Chips Away At Application Backlog
This article was originally published in The Tan Sheet
Executive Summary
Canada's temporary regulations promulgated in 2010 to help reduce the backlog of natural health product applications are effective so far, a Canadian food and drug attorney says.
